The following tasks are used frequently when you manage segments for your Foundation Fieldbus and Profibus systems.

Create a Foundation Fieldbus Segment

A Foundation Fieldbus segment is a group of devices physically connected by a single pair of wires to a host control device. This procedure explains how to add a new segment to your fieldbus system.

Edit the Properties of a Foundation Fieldbus Segment

This feature allows to edit the properties of a Foundation Fieldbus segment. You can rename a segment, select another segment-wide parameter profile, and set the segment as intrinsically safe.

Delete a Fieldbus Segment

Use this feature to delete a segment.

Associate an Instrument with a Segment

This feature enables you to associate a segment with a particular instrument. You use this feature if for some reason, the current tag number has not been associated with any segment or if you need to change some of the associations. Note that the association or any changes made to the association will affect the current tag number only.

Dissociate an Instrument from a Segment

You use this procedure when you need to dissociate a particular instrument from its segment.

Enable a Function Block for I/O Assignment

This procedure shows how to enable a function block for I/O assignment. You can do this after associating an instrument with a segment. Note that without enabling function blocks, segment I/O assignment cannot be effected.
